Transaction 134821eb3160550c82c95ca46329d167b46eab21b0820d91ac54b6c5f37519f4

1 Input
2 Outputs
  • 134821eb3160550c82c95ca46329d167b46eab21b0820d91ac54b6c5f37519f4:0
  • value  14275805
    address  379grSZxqWbtVKTpLEKcmQzvAujYDGw7WA
  • 134821eb3160550c82c95ca46329d167b46eab21b0820d91ac54b6c5f37519f4:1
  • value  86652378
    address  1Q85xyWSi2ED2rC4ZWUogjnsLwRC2SaD3K